Why Adoption is Slower in Vacation Hotels
Vacation resorts face unique challenges when it comes to adopting revenue management technology. Unlike traditional hotels, these kinds of properties often rely heavily on tour operators for bookings. This reliance can make it difficult to implement an RMS that optimize transient segment pricing and global distribution costs.
Furthermore, the seasonal nature of this sector, with high demand during peak periods and lower occupancy during off-peak seasons, presents a challenge in implementing consistent pricing strategies.
However, with the right strategies and technology, vacation properties can overcome these challenges and reap the benefits.
The Challenge of Beating Tour Operation and Optimizing Distribution Costs
One of the primary challenges for resorts is optimizing distribution costs while beating tour operation competition. Many holiday hotels are highly dependent on intermediaries, facing high distribution costs, not only in commissions but also in marketing fees and rappels on sales. Being able to manage these costs is essential for business success and optimising long-term net profitability.
Revenue management technology provides the tools to monitor and control not only inventory allocation, ensuring optimal pricing for tour operators, but also distribution costs, allowing access to in-depth knowledge of the distribution mix and opening up the possibility to renegotiate contracts based on the data. By analyzing historical data and market dynamics, resorts can negotiate more favorable conditions with tour operators, minimizing distribution costs and maximizing revenue from this segment.
The technology also enables alternatives to identify demand patterns in different segments and adjust inventory allocation, reducing reliance on tour operators when direct bookings are more profitable.
Optimizing Distribution Mix with AI Sales Strategies Recommendations
Advanced revenue management technology employs AI algorithms to provide sales strategy recommendations, enhance distribution mix, and attract more direct bookings. These algorithms consider factors such as historical booking patterns, market demand, competitor pricing, and customer behavior.
By analyzing this data, resorts can implement effective pricing strategies, personalized packages, and promotions to appeal to different customer segments. The technology's dynamic pricing capabilities allow businesses to adjust rates based on occupancy levels, demand fluctuations, and even external factors like weather forecasts. This flexibility ensures optimal revenue generation throughout different seasons.
